WATERBORO – Waterboro Public Library has been selected as a beneficiary of the Hannaford Helps Reusable Bag Program for the month of October.
The Hannaford Helps Reusable Bag Program launched in October 2015 and is designed to support local non-profits through the sale of the reusable Community Bags.
Waterboro Public Library was selected by Hannaford store leadership as the October beneficiary of the program at the Waterboro Hannaford store. For every reusable Community Bag purchased at the Waterboro Hannaford during October, Waterboro Public Library will receive a $1 donation.
“We are so pleased to be selected for this program said Waterboro Public Library Director, Julie Hoyle. Donations from the sale of these reusable bags will be used to purchase additional Lego® bricks for the new children’s Lego Club program.”
